CHUCK WEST WINS VENTURA TQ MAIN – By Tim Kennedy

Ventura, CA., Jul 11 – Eleven NMRA -TQ midget team raced Saturday in a multi-division program topped by VRA 360 sprint cars. It was the third TQ event of the season at Jim Naylor's fifth-mile clay Ventura Raceway and the second 20-lap feature triumph this season for Chuck West, from Clovis, at the oceanfront speedway. The five-time NMRA driving champion (2002, 06, 08, 11 and 12) now has won four of the nine TQ main events this season. He was not present for one race. His other victories came at tracks in Bakersfield and Santa Maria.

West started fourth in the West Evans Motor-sports No. 38 Stealth/Kawasaki. He moved up a position from third to second in current points and trails his car owner/first cousin West Evans by only seven points. Bruce Hiroshima, the point leader after seven events, missed race eight at Bakersfield and fell to fourth place in driver points. He returned to action in Ventura and drove from eighth starting spot to second place in his No. 5 Stewart chassis with a Clerc Honda engine.

Point leader Evans started seventh in his No. 38 Spike/Bob Wirth Suzuki and finished third. Chris Thomas started second and finished fourth. Scott Niven, the ninth starter, crossed the finish line fifth. Rookies Kevin Kale and his first-time car owner father Ace Kale started fifth and third. They finished sixth and seventh respectively.

Scott Dobson came home eighth after starting sixth. Dave Lambert started last (11th) and completed all 20 laps. Pole starter Doyle Mosley, brother of the late Indianapolis 500 driver Mike Mosley, logged 18 laps for P. 10. Rookie Paul Sanders started outside row five and ran 15 laps.

West started third and won the first eight lap heat race. Pole starter Thomas led all eight laps to win the second heat race. The next NMRA-TQ event will be held Saturday, July 25 at Bakersfield Speedway. The final six TQ races will be conducted at the Bakersfield and Santa Maria tracks. Each speedway will host three race dates.
